1. Download MySql + MySqlWorkBench
Visit the MySQL official website http://dev.mysql.com/downloads/
Or http://pan.baidu.com/s/1gdu40T1
"MySQL Community Server" and "MySQL Workbench" are displayed on the homepage"
Take MySQL Community Server as an example.
Click the DOWNLOAD button to go To the DOWNLOAD selection page. By default, "mac OS X" has been selected for the current system to list the mysql versions available for DOWNLOAD.
Select Mac OS X 10.9 (x86, 64-bit), DMG Archive (64-bit dmg file), and click DownLoad To Go To The DownLoad page.
Select "No thanks, just start my download." at the bottom to start the download.
"MySQL Workbench" is also downloaded in this way
Ii. Installation
After the download is complete, start installation. First install mysql and double-click the mysql installation package.
Double-click the installation and the installation will appear in the preference settings of the system.
Now turn on the system preference settings and find that mysql has been successfully installed.
Install MySQL Workbench now. Open the installation package and drag MySQLWorkBench to Applications.
Iii. Use
Find MySQLWorkBench in the system application and open
Then you need to connect MySQLWorkBench to mySql for unified management.
The main interface consists of three modules: MySQL Connection, Shortcuts, and Models.
There is a "+" button on the right side of MySQL Connection. After clicking it, a "Setup New Connection" dialog box is displayed. after entering the Connection Name, click OK. You can complete a connection to the local database.
After you click OK, the connection you just created will appear on the main page.
Click the new connection John and enter the secret. The account information is root/root by default. The following database operation page is displayed.
There are four modules on the left: MANAGEMENT, INSTANCE, PERFORMANCE, and SCHEMAS. The MySQL service can be started or disabled under the INSTANCE, and all databases connected to the current INSTANCE are displayed under SCHEMAS, A database named test is created by default. Here we can Create a new database, right-click the blank space at SCHEMAS, and select "Create Schema ..."
Enter the database Name at Scheme Name and click apply. Then, click apply to create a database.
Alternatively, you can use an SQL statement to CREATE a database: CREATE SCHEMA database name;
After creation, click the refresh button on the Right of SCHEMAS to refresh SCHEMAS. A new database is added under SCHEMAS.
Right-click the Database Name and select "Set as Default Schema". The SQL statements written later are all operations performed on the database by Default.
